I'm new to using a release - scott little bitty goose , and am starting to have trouble . Will touching the body of the release while pulling the trigger cause it to hang up a bit , cuz that's what's starting to happen every couple of shots . Any advice would be helpful .
#2
Not if it's a good release. Years ago I used to use the Failsafe thumb release (no longer made) which was as good as they come for about $20. Now you have to spend over $100 to get something that good. Since it's one of the most important parts of shooting success I wouldn't scrimp on a cheap one.
Looking at the release you have it would seem to be okay and has gotten good reviews. The trigger should work independent of the bow weight on a good release.
I'd attach it to something other then the bowstring and play with it some to see what might be happening.
